Acetyl CoA Carboxylase (ACC), captures carbon dioxide in de novo fatty acid synthesis. What prosthetic group is used by ACC for this reaction?
Biotin
What molecule serves as the reductant in fatty acid synthesis?
NADPH
Fatty acid synthesis involves a repeated series of reactions. What is the source of the three-carbon group that is added, repeatedly, to the growing end of a fatty-acylated ACP during elongation?
Malonyl-CoA

In fatty acid synthesis, what reactants are brought together to produce malonyl CoA?
Acetyl CoA, CO2, and ATP

Belongs to sphingolipid
What amino acid is an immediate precursor to sphingolipids?
Serine
What molecule is synthesized in the first committed step of cholesterol synthesis?
Mevalonate
Where are fatty acids stored? In what form?
Fatty acids are stored in adipose tissue in the form of triacylglycerides
Describe the first step in fatty acid degradation:
Formation of an acyl-adenylate with liberation of pyrophosphate
What is the ligand that helps transport acyl groups into the mitochondrial matrix?
Carnitine

In the synthesis of fatty acids, which molecule move acetyl groups from the cytoplasm to mitochondria?
Citrate
Fatty acid synthase is a complex of proteins that catalyze steps in the formation of fatty acids. Name the subunit that becomes covalently linked to a growing fatty acid chain:
Acyl carrier protein
How many molecules of acetyl-CoA are needed for biosynthesis of the C18 fatty acids stored, sterate?
9
What molecule participates in the first step in the biosynthesis of phosphatidate?
Glycerol-3-phosphate (GAP)

The first committed step of cholesterol biosynthesis is catalyzed by?
HMG-CoAReductase
What lipoprotein transports dietary lipids from the intestine to the liver?
Chylomicrons
Which enzyme in the citric acid cycle will be allosterically inhibited and thereby drive the fatty acids stored synthesis pathway when metabolic conditions favor fat storage?
Isocitrate Dehdrogenase

Within cholesterol biosynthesis, the endoplasmic reticulum is the site of:
Squalene Cyclization
Where do the two-carbon units that are used to extend the fatty acyl chain come directly from?
Malonyl-ACP
What hormone would you expect to POSITEVELY regulate acetyl-CoA carboxylase?
Insulin
In the synthesis of phosphatidylinositol, the “activated” precursor is:
CDP-diacylglycerol
The fatty-acyl groups are connected to the glycerol moiety by?
Ester linkages
The hydrolysis of ester linkages are catalyzed by:
Hormone-sensitive lipase
What is the first step in the oxidative degradation pathway of fatty acids?
Formation of an acyl adenylate
As part of the first committed step in fatty acid synthesis, Acetyl-CoA Carboxylase forms a covalent intermediate with CO2. Acetyl CoA Carboxylase is regulated by a protein kinase and by binding a small molecule. Correctly describe these regulatory function:
Acetyl CoACarboxylase is inhibited by phosphorylation and activated by binding citrate
Squalene is a 30-carbon precursor to cholesterol. How many molecules of Mevalonate are required for biosynthesis of one molecule of squalene?
6
Fatty acid synthesis and citric acid cycle are interconnected because one citric-acid-cycle intermediate serves as the key precursor for fatty acid biosynthesis. Which intermediate is this?
Citrate is this intermediate
